**Ticket: Config drift on receipt mailer**

Hey — the Lanternpost donation-receipt mailer in staging has quietly drifted from what's in the Hollowfen repo. Someone hand-tweaked the retry and TLS settings back in spring and never committed them, so receipts from the Brindlemoor campaign went out over a weaker cipher set for weeks. Could you eyeball this before we reconcile? For reference, here's what the staging box is actually running right now.

service settings:
PRAIX_LOG_LEVEL=error
PRAIX_METRICS_HOST=metrics.praix.qorvelcorp.corp
PRAIX_POOL_SIZE=16

# Runbook: Hunting leaked file descriptors in Quillgate

When the `fd_open` gauge climbs steadily between deploys, suspect a leak rather than load. First confirm on a single pod: exec in and count entries under `/proc/1/fd`, noting how many are sockets in CLOSE_WAIT versus regular files. Capture two snapshots ten minutes apart before restarting anything — we need the delta for the postmortem. Reproduce locally with the Marbury load harness, which requires the service running with the following configuration values.

settings of yagep-bajog:
[istdor]
port = 4000
region = south-2
host = istdor.qorvelcorp.internal
timeout_ms = 5000
retries = 5

## Limits and Quotas: Brooksweep Retention Sweeper

Brooksweep deletes expired records from the Harrowfield archive tier on a rolling schedule. To protect foreground query latency, the sweeper throttles itself by partition, never holding more than one tombstone lock at a time and yielding whenever replica lag exceeds the guard threshold. Quotas are enforced per run, not per day. The tuning constants in effect this quarter are listed below.

tuning table, fawip-fahag:
WEIGHTS = {
    "novwyn": 452,
    "casdor": 675,
}

Subject: Quickstore 4.2 — bloom filter now fronts the KV layer

Plugin authors: starting with this release, Quickstore places a bloom filter ahead of the key-value store. Negative lookups return faster; false positives fall through safely. No API changes are required on your side. Verify your plugin against the staging build referenced below.

session token of fahif-tadup = htk3_9c7